    Adnan Syed is a convicted murderer and sentenced to life at the Baltimore Corrections Facility. The woman he murdered was a senior at Woodlawn High School‚ Hae Min Lee‚ who was also his ex-girlfriend. Hae Min Lee went missing after school on Friday‚ January 13‚ 1999. On February 9‚ 1999‚ her body was found in Leakin Park‚ a victim of manual strangulation.
